Can the body defend itself against illnesses?

Contents show

In general, the way in which your body defends itself against sickness is by preventing foreign substances from entering the body. Physical barriers, such as your skin, are your first line of protection against infectious bacteria and viruses. You also create chemicals that kill pathogens, such as lysozyme, which may be found on sections of your body that are not covered by skin. These parts include your mucous membranes and tears.

What are the three ways the body defends itself against illness?

The immune system works in conjunction with the body’s inherent defense mechanisms to guard against potentially dangerous illnesses. The skin, the mucous membranes, tears, and stomach acid all act as natural barriers to the outside world. The flow of urine also helps wash away any bacteria that may have entered that urinary system. This helps keep the urinary tract clean and healthy.

What defends the body against disease?

The white blood cells in your body are the most important components of your immune system. They are a component of the lymphatic system and are produced in the bone marrow of your body. White blood cells travel through the blood and the tissues of your body in search of microorganisms, or foreign invaders, such as bacteria, viruses, parasites, and fungus. White blood cells also seek for cancer cells.

What is the body’s initial line of defense against a virus?

The initial line of defense against infection is made up of the skin, tears, and mucus produced by the body. They are an important part of our defense against invading infectious agents.

Can a virus make you immune to it?

The development of natural immunity takes place when an individual has been infected by a pathogen and their immune system has produced antibodies in response to the pathogen. It’s possible that the infection will make you unwell. But if you come into contact with that germ again in the future, your immune system will recognize it and mount a response using antibodies. It is now less probable that you may become infected again as a result of this.

How does the immune system in humans function?

How does the body’s defense mechanism work? When the body comes into contact with foreign substances, it calls these antigens, and the immune system goes to work to determine what they are and eliminate them. When activated, B cells begin the production of antibodies (also called immunoglobulins). These proteins attach themselves to certain antigens.

Does taking medication impair immune function?

A number of drugs can reduce the effectiveness of your immune system. This may be intentional in certain circumstances, such as after an organ transplant has been performed. In some instances, the condition is the result of a negative reaction to a particular medication’s adverse effects. If you have a compromised immune system, you put yourself at a greater risk of contracting an illness.

What occurs if your immune system malfunctions?

If your immune system is entirely compromised, you will have no natural defenses remaining against disease. Because of this, you are more likely to contract “opportunistic infections,” which are diseases that can even be spread by items that wouldn’t normally be harmful to you.

How much of the population is immune?

Scientists believe that in order for herd immunity to be effective, somewhere between seventy and ninety percent (sup>3/sup>) of a population must be immune to a disease. This immunity can be acquired in one of two ways: either by having the disease and then recovering from it, or by receiving a vaccine that protects against the disease. This approaches the point when the herd immunity threshold is reached, as defined by the World Health Organization (WHO).

How can you tell if you have Covid immunity?

Testing for Antibodies and Immunity to Coronavirus

The presence or absence of immunity to coronavirus cannot be determined by antibody testing. They are a straightforward way to determine whether or not you have been infected with the virus. Even if you have had the infection before, it does not automatically indicate that you are immune to it.

How long do antibodies remain in your body?

It can take two to three weeks after infection with the COVID-19 virus to build enough antibodies to be detectable in an antibody test. Because of this, it is vital to avoid getting tested too soon after becoming infected with the virus. After you have recovered from COVID-19, there is a possibility that antibodies will still be present in your blood for several months or even longer.

How is the immune system measured in blood?

Blood tests can evaluate the quantities of blood cells and immune system cells as well as establish whether or not you have usual levels of infection-fighting proteins (immunoglobulins) in your blood. If the quantities of particular cells in your blood are outside of the normal range, this may be an indication that there is a problem with your immune system.
